Came across this Lebanese place while walking around knightsbridge. The area is home to many Middle Eastern restaurants and cafes. We were really hungry so thought of trying this place out. It wasn't the best Lebanese food to be honest but it wasn't bad either. It's a great location and is only steps away from one of the Hyde Park entrances. They have good vegetarian and non vegetarian options. We tried both and it didn't disappoint. They have indoor and outdoor seating available. Decent wine and beer menu. Food was above average but lacked the wow factor. A bit on the expensive side as its in a fancy area. The service was fast and helpful. There are much better Lebanese food options just on the other side of Hyde Park near marble arch and Edgware.
